About Us
The Multicultural Education Alliance (MEA) was formed to partner with minority students, parents, teachers, educational institutions and communities to improve educational opportunities and student achievement. MEA seeks to: promote open dialogue and collaborative efforts between parents, administrators, educators, students, lawmakers and community leaders to ensure quality education for minority students; provide information to the public on issues related to education; provide access to tools and resources needed to ensure real gains and success for all students; and develop strong, informed communities that will provide the backbone and support structure for a skilled workforce.
As an active outreach not-for-profit organization, MEA encourages partnerships with businesses to create programs that will prepare our children to become a world-class workforce.
